Warnock expects no action over v-sign
Sheffield United manager Neil Warnock is confident he will escape any Football Association charge despite admitting flashing a v-sign at Norwich manager Nigel Worthington after Saturday’s defeat to Norwich.
Warnock was incensed the former Sheffield Wednesday defender ignored him, refusing a handshake after the Canaries’ 2-1 win at Carrow Road.
Referee Paul Taylor is believed to have mentioned he incident in his match report but Warnock remains unrepentant.
“I won’t deny that I flipped my fingers in his direction, but only because I was so disgusted and frustrated at being humiliated by a fellow manager,” Warnock told The Yorkshire Post.
“If the same circumstances arose I would do the same again.
“I held out my hand for six or seven seconds but he kept on talking and turned his back. There was no mix-up. He even looked me in the eyes."
